•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

İndicatör

Office2000'e kadar olan versiyonlarda değişmez.

Office2000'in üzerindeki versiyonlarda ise; ya buradaki üyeler, ya da dosyanızdaki açıklama hücresine yazdığınız sitedeki üyeler yardımcı olabilir.
 
Sub Indicatordegistir()
Dim ws As Worksheet
Dim cmt As Comment
Dim rngCmt As Range
Dim shpCmt As Shape
Dim shpW As Double
Dim shpH As Double

Set ws = ActiveSheet
shpW = 6
shpH = 4

For Each cmt In ws.Comments
Set rngCmt = cmt.Parent
With rngCmt
Set shpCmt = ws.Shapes.AddShape(msoShapeRightTriangle, _
rngCmt.Offset(0, 1).Left - shpW, .Top, shpW, shpH)
End With
With shpCmt
.Flip msoFlipVertical
.Flip msoFlipHorizontal
.Fill.ForeColor.SchemeColor = 12
.Fill.Visible = msoTrue
.Fill.Solid
.Line.Visible = msoFalse
End With
Next cmt

End Sub


.Fill.ForeColor.SchemeColor = kısmına 12 yazarsanız mavi 57 yazarsanız yeşil renk elde edeceksiniz 10 ise standar olan kırmızı renk olacaktır.
 
Çok teşekkürler Haluk bey ve fructose.

Görüşmek üzere çok selamlar.
 
Geri
Üst